What's The Definition Of Professorship?
[n] the position of professor; "he was awarded an endowed chair in economics"
Synonyms | Synonyms for Professorship: chair Related Terms | Find terms related to Professorship: See Also | berth | office | place | position | post | situation | spot Professorship In Webster's Dictionary \Pro*fess"or*ship\, n.
The office or position of a professor, or public teacher.
